    Andy , I Have a 2013 Jeep JKUR (4 Door) and was thinking about the M8000-S , Will that be big enough for my needs ? Any advice will be greatly appreciated . Thanks .

  8. #68
    Join Date
    Oct 2010
    Location
    Oregon
    Posts
    677
    Quote Originally Posted by Rockhard426 View Post
    Andy , I Have a 2013 Jeep JKUR (4 Door) and was thinking about the M8000-S , Will that be big enough for my needs ? Any advice will be greatly appreciated . Thanks .
    We recommend a 9,000 or 9,500 lb. capacity winch for the JKU. I'd suggest the XD9000 or 9000i, the 9.5cti (or 9.5cti-s with our Spydura synthetic), or 9.5xp or 9.5xp-s.
